Awoman measures the angle of elevation of a mountaintop as 12.0°. after walking 1.00 km closer to the mountain on level ground, she fi nds the angle to be 14.0°. (a) draw a picture of the problem, neglecting the height of the woman's eyes above the ground. hint: use two triangles. (b) select variable names for the mountain height (suggestion: y) and the woman’s original distance from the mountain (suggestion: x) and label the picture. (c) using the labeled picture and the tangent function, write two trigonometric equations relating the two selected variables. (d) find the height y of the mountain by fi rst solving one equation for x and substituting the result into the other equation.
